Expert Review
This position offers a solid pay range of $23.84 to $27.78 per hour, which is competitive for dockworker roles. MaziCTools emphasizes growth, but the reality is that the job can be quite demanding. Many workers report the workload as heavy, leading to potential burnout.
The benefits package is described as industry-leading, yet specifics aren't provided, making it worth inquiring about during the interview. Customer service and support from management are also points of contention, with varying experiences reported by employees.
